資料庫查詢排除重覆記錄的方法

2022-09-21 10:21:09 字數 559 閱讀 1897

今天由於工作需要,需程式設計客棧要在資料庫中找出某一字段下不同的記錄值,很簡單的問題被我想的太複雜,很doyfu是鬱悶,原因是sql的一條命令忘了,現問題已解決,趕快拿來做備忘。

其實這裡只需要用到sql中的distinct命令即可,非常簡單,語法如下:

複製** www.cppcns.com**如下:

select dist程式設計客棧inct 列名稱 from 表名稱

舉例說明:

假設現有乙個資料庫表:htmer:

複製** **如下:

field001

記錄1記錄2

記錄1記錄3

現在這張表中有四條記錄,但有一條記錄是重複的,如果我要去掉該重覆記錄,只列出不重覆記錄的sql語句是:

複製** **如下:

select distinct fdoyfuield001 from htmer

結果如下:

複製** **如下:

field001

記錄1記錄2

記錄3

本文標題: 資料庫查詢排除重覆記錄的方法

本文位址:

資料庫刪除重覆記錄

刪除重覆記錄 sql delete from wzh questions a where a.rowid select max rowid from lunar b where a.shuaho b.shuhao and a.tihao b.tihao 整理insert語句 select inser...

SQL語句查詢資料庫中重覆記錄的個數

複製 如下 select a,b,c,count 程式設計客棧 fro程式設計客棧m select c.a,c.b,c.c from test www.cppcns.comh ing count 2 group by a,b,c 或者 複製 如下 select zdbh,tdzl,zdmj,coun...

七 MySql資料庫實現更新不重覆記錄

一 主要物件導向 在mysql中更新記錄的時候,要求某個欄位的值保證唯一。二 案例 1.系統使用者表 create table sys user id int 11 not null auto increment comment 主鍵 group id int 11 default null com...